If students hold a bachelor’s degree or equivalent, but don’t meet the entry requirements for a master’s, a Pre-Master’s can help them gain a place on a postgraduate degree. For progression to the 1st year of a postgraduate degree at the University of Essex. Course length is determined mainly by students' English language level (UKVI IELTS score).
Students on all course lengths take a set of common or similar modules to gain a solid base of skills for university. If their course is longer than 2 terms, students will take additional modules designed to improve one or more of their English language level, academic skills, and basic knowledge of particular subjects.
Master of Science - Conflict Resolution This University of Essex course helps students understand the evolving field of conflict resolution, exploring the causes and effects of destructive conflict across the world, and scrutinising the theory and practice of how it can be managed peacefully. Students learn advanced quantitative skills to build upon their statistical background. Students should consider Essex's MA Conflict Resolution if they don’t have a strong background in statistics.
Students have access to leading conflict resolution experts in Essex's Michael Nicholson Centre for Conflict and Cooperation and the opportunity to collaborate on research. They also host popular talks with experts, and with prestigious external speakers, helping students develop a deeper knowledge of conflict resolution.
Essex provides students with a framework for understanding conflict resolution in inter-state and intra-state issues, focusing on topics including: • mediation, negotiation, and collaborative problem-solving; • using conflict data sets and drawing geographical maps; • international development and human rights; • international relations and security studies; • global and comparative politics.
Essex's dynamic, interdisciplinary approach combines traditional methods with contemporary theory and practices of non-violent movements. Essex encourages students to experience the practical as well as the theoretical application of these topics through examining real case studies of international conflict.
All Essex politics graduates have the distinction of a qualification from one of the world’s leading politics departments.
This course will prepare students for a career in areas such as non-governmental organisations, international and national government, or the private sector. Recent graduates have gone on to work for the following high-profile organisations: the Civil Service, local government, the World Bank, the United Nations, NATO, YouGov and YouGov America.
